Protection Against Benign Breast Tumors, Medicine
Dr. Álvaro Monterrosa Castro, MD
The breasts can be affected by pathologies that consist of benign proliferation. Conditions that must be studied both clinically and by pathological anatomy, to differentiate them from breast cancer. There are a variety of classifications of benign breast disease.
The most common condition is called fibrocystic mastopathy, although many other terms are used. It is characterized by proliferation and regression of breast tissues with abnormal interrelation of the epithelium with the connective tissue (81).
The second most common pathology belonging to benign breast disease is fibroadenoma, which consists of a proliferation of connective tissue and epithelium.
Benign breast disease is a frequent cause of consultation and a great producer of anxiety, since affected women often believe they have cancer (82,84,102).
The maximum rate of appearance of fibroadenoma is between 20 and 39 years and that of fibrocystic mastopathy is between 40 and 50 years.

Microdose oral contraceptives
It has been asserted that microdose oral contraceptives are related to a lower incidence of cystic fibrosis of the breast RR: 0.6 (CI: 0.4 – 0.9) and breast fibroadenoma RR: 0.35 (CI: 0.2 – 0.7). Benign conditions that, as has been said, should not be confused with breast carcinoma. In this regard, the group brought together by the World Health Organization analyzed 15 case-control studies and 3 cohort studies, most of them carried out in the 1970s. Where it is observed that oral contraceptives have a protective effect and reduce the risk of benign breast disease by 25%.
This protection increases the longer the duration of pill use, and is related to the progestin content, with greater protection the higher the hormonal potency (81).
Because the components and doses of combined oral contraceptives have changed over time and continue to change, it would be unlikely that results from previous studies could be applied to modern formulations, therefore, the potency of these drugs needs to be investigated. the different classes of estrogens and progestogens, as well as their effects on the mammary gland.
